Support Packages from Iowa State University

The ISU Pet Loss Support Hotline maintains printed literature to help you deal with the death or potential loss of your pet. The support packages are free of charge to the public and animal shelters.

Veterinary clinics may request pet loss support literature to place in their clinics. The Pet Loss Support Hotline requests a minimal donation to cover expenses. Currently the Pet Loss Support Hotline requests $15/100 brochures and $10/100 sympathy card enclosures to cover printing, postage and handling.

Support packages generally contains the following:

*Article on pet loss and bereavement for adults
*Article on pet loss and bereavement for children (if applicable)
*A brochure from the American Veterinary Medical Association or the American Animal Hospital Association
*Pet Loss Support Hotline brochure
*Other applicable material

To receive a support package, please send your request to the following address. Include the name and species (dog, cat, bird, etc.) of your pet and a little information about your situation. Please be sure to indicate whether you are representing a veterinarian/clinic.

ISU Pet Loss Support Hotline
2116 Veterinary Medicine
Iowa State University
Ames, Iowa 50011

ATTN: SUPPORT PACKAGES
